Vælg sprog

Udvikleroversigt

Siden Developer giver adgang til Shiftons API-dokumentation og værktøjer til oprettelse af brugerdefinerede integrationer.


Trinvise instruktioner

Adgang til siden Developer

1
Klik på Integrationer i venstre sidepanel.
2
Gå til siden Udvikler.
3
Øverst findes tre faner: Oversigt, Webhooks og Ansøgninger.

Brug af fanen Overview

LinkBeskrivelse
Ny dokumentationAktuel API-dokumentation
Gammel dokumentationForældet dokumentation til eksisterende integrationer

Klik på det ønskede link — dokumentationen åbnes i en ny fane.

Andre Developer-faner

1
Webhooks
mdash; konfigurér slutpunkter til begivenhedsnotifikationer i realtid.
2
Ansøgninger
mdash; opret og administrér brugerdefinerede applikationer.

Relaterede artikler

Shifton screenshot

Ofte stillede spørgsmål

Sp: Hvilken dokumentation skal man bruge — den nye eller den gamle?
Brug Ny dokumentation til alle nye integrationer. Den gamle er kun til bagudkompatibilitet.

Sp: Siden Udvikler vises ikke — hvorfor?
Siden er kun tilgængelig for Ejer.

Sp: Er der begrænsninger på antallet af API-forespørgsler?
Ja. Se detaljer i API-dokumentationen.

Sp: Hvor finder man API-nøglen til skifton API?
Integrations → Udvikler → Ansøgninger → opret en applikation → i indstillingerne får De API-legitimationsoplysninger.

Sp: Understøtter skifton OAuth 2.0?
Ja. Autorisation via OAuth bruges til at tilslutte tredjepartsapplikationer. Se detaljer i API-dokumentationen.

Sp: Kan man teste API uden at oprette en applikation?
Ja — brug værktøjer som Postman med Deres legitimationsoplysninger. Til produktion anbefales det at registrere en applikation.

Sp: Hvad er forskellen mellem New og Gammel dokumentation?
Ny dokumentation — aktuel (anbefales til alle nye integrationer). Gammel dokumentation — til bagudkompatibilitet med eksisterende integrationer.

Sp: Kan man hente rapportdata via API?
Ja. Shiftons API giver adgang til vagtplan-, medarbejder- og andre ressourcedata. Se detaljer i dokumentationen.

Sp: Understøtter webhooks alle typer af skifton-begivenheder?
Nej, kun bestemte. Listen over understøttede begivenheder findes i afsnittet Developer → Webhooks i dokumentationen.

Sp: Kræves der teknisk viden for at arbejde med API?
Ja. Arbejde med REST API og oprettelse af integrationer via Applications kræver grundlæggende udviklingsevner.

Sp: Er API betalingspålagt eller inkluderet i abonnementet?
API er tilgængelig inden for abonnementet uden ekstra betaling. Begrænsninger afhænger af abonnementsplanen.

Sp: Hvordan får man support ved problemer med API-integration?
Kontakt Shifton-support med en beskrivelse af forespørgslen, svaret og fejlkoden. Læs også dokumentationen på siden Developer.

Sp: Hvad er basis-URL for skifton API?
Basis-URL er api2.shifton.com. Detaljer og eksempler på forespørgsler findes i Ny dokumentation.

Sp: Understøtter API paginering ved forespørgsel af store Listeeer?
Ja. Detaljer om implementering af paginering er beskrevet i API-dokumentationen.

Sp: Kan man oprette og slette vagter via API?
Ja. API giver fuld CRUD-adgang til vagter, medarbejdere, vagtplaner og andre ressourcer.

Sp: Er der et sandbox-miljø til test af API?
Der er ikke et dedikeret sandbox-miljø. Det anbefales at oprette en testvirksomhed i Shifton til sikker testning.

Sp: Hvilke dataOpretater understøtter API?
API bruger JSON-format til forespørgsler og svar.